Course Overview

Primary Education Years 1-6 is a full-time primary school program designed for international students aged 6–12. The course covers all key learning areas of the Australian Curriculum, including English, mathematics, science, humanities, arts, and physical education. Over six years (312 weeks), students develop critical thinking, literacy, and numeracy skills in a supportive, English-speaking environment. Duration and Study Mode

The course is delivered full-time over 6 years (312 weeks on the CRICOS register). Language of instruction is English. It is a single qualification (no dual awards) and does not include a foundation studies component. Students are expected to attend classes daily at MLC's campus in Claremont, with a school year typically running from late January to December, following the Western Australian school calendar.

Fees (Indicative)

Tuition fee: A$272,031 (indicative, set by Methodist Ladies' College). Non-tuition fees (e.g., uniform, excursions, textbooks): A$43,924. Estimated total: A$315,955. These fees are sourced from the CRICOS register as at April 2026 and are subject to change. Additional costs include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), living expenses (approx. A$500–800 per week for rent, food, and transport in Perth), and the student visa application charge. Always confirm current fees with MLC's admissions office. Student Visa Requirements

International students studying this course require a Student visa (Subclass 500). Students under 18 must usually have a Student Guardian visa (Subclass 590) for an accompanying parent or guardian. Key visa conditions include: genuine temporary entrant (GTE) requirement, maintenance of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), and sufficient financial capacity. Once aged 14 and above, student work rights allow 48 hours per fortnight during term and unlimited hours during scheduled breaks.
